5.10.2

Setting to Enable/Disable Overtravel

Use PnBA4 (Input Signal Settings) to enable/disable the overtravel function.
You do not need to wire the overtravel input signals if you are not going to use the overtravel
function.

5.10.4

Motor Stopping Method for Overtravel

Use PnB1A (Hardware Limit Action Selection) to set the Servomotor stopping method when
overtravel occurs.

*1.
If overtravel occurs, the servo will be turned OFF regardless of the rotation direction.
*2.
The motor will stop if overtravel occurs, but you can input a reference to drive the motor in the opposite direc-
tion.
